WOW thats alot crickets! But how many does a 3-4 Month old ussualy eat? Also I would like to breed my own crickets can you give me some info on a good breeding setup thats not bigger than a rubbermaid bin?
Jay
If you only need to feed one dragon, then it would not be worth the effort to breed your own crix.
However, FYI, I order ALL my crix as LAYERS. I'll set them up in a Sterlite container(1000per container) with food, 2 large carrots, and 2 smaller containers that have moist vermiculite. Then I don't even touch them for a couple days. I'll clean out the cricket bins, giving them all fresh food & carrots. Removing the smaller containers. I put a lid on the smaller containers with the date. Incubate for about 9 days at 90*. When the little crix start hatching, I'll put them in another sterlite container with lots of places to crawl. Cricket chow on the bottom for food, and a poultry water dish for water. I don't use the spongy things that come with them. I use paper towels so they can be more easily cleaned. A couple days before I start using them to feed my babies, I'll shake out what I'll need into another container with greens, carrots, and dry baby cereal to gutload.
I'm sure other people have different techniques for breeding crix, but this way works great for me.

Oh, I almost forgot to answer your other question. How much does a 3-4 month old eat? Probably around 600 crix monthly, give or take a few.
